Position Summary

The Shift Supervisor plays a key leadership role, oversees the daily activities of safety, quality, and production, and leads employees in all production procedures during the shift. The Shift Supervisor will serve as a liaison between management and the hourly operations team.

This is an exempt level position.

Job Responsibilities
  • Coordinate daily operations performed by hourly production colleagues to ensure work is performed safely and efficiently while meeting expected environmental quality, housekeeping, and production quantity goals established by the company.
  • Provide employees with resources in good working order to perform tasks safely and efficiently.
  • Provide training to ensure employees understand operational procedures, SOPs, safe work practices, PPE requirements, and policies.
  • Create and assign tasks to effectively utilize team members' experience and capabilities.
  • Ensure the safety of all colleagues through training and compliance with occupational safety, health and environmental regulations, and leading by example.
  • Listen to and respond to colleague suggestions and concerns about safety, health, environment, product quality and housekeeping, and communicate concerns and improvement initiatives to all colleagues.
  • Address employee concerns and maintain good communications and morale on shift and within department, keeping plant management informed of all matters affecting morale and safety.
  • Evaluate colleague performance, provide regular feedback, and discuss disciplinary action with superintendents and human resources.
  • Attend and participate in operation area meetings, safety meetings, and supervisor’s meetings.
  • May perform production duties temporarily in the event of an emergency or employee absence.
  • Perform GEMBA walks.
  • Track and achieve KPI goals.
  • Recognize environmental, safety, and GMP hazards and contain them to avoid negative effects on colleague safety, product quality, and environmental pollution.
  • May perform reasonably similar or related duties as required.
